Q: Is 51,818,385 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 51,818,385 is a composite number.

Why is 51,818,385 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 51,818,385 can be evenly divided by 1 3 5 15 1,789 1,931 5,367 5,793 8,945 9,655 26,835 28,965 3,454,559 10,363,677 17,272,795 and 51,818,385, with no remainder.

Since 51,818,385 cannot be divided by just 1 and 51,818,385, it is a composite number.
